Understanding the Core Mechanisms of Live View Dash Cams
Live view dash cams aren’t just fancy gadgets.
They’re sophisticated pieces of technology designed to provide real-time visual feedback.
At their heart, these systems leverage wireless communication protocols, primarily Wi-Fi, to transmit video data from the camera sensor to a connected device, usually a smartphone or an in-car display.
The core idea is to bridge the gap between recording and immediate situational awareness.
Wi-Fi Connectivity: The Backbone of Live View
Most common live view dash cams utilize a direct Wi-Fi connection.
This means the dash cam itself acts as a small Wi-Fi hotspot.
Your smartphone connects directly to this Wi-Fi network, much like it would to your home router.
- Local Access: This setup allows you to view the live feed and access recorded footage when you are within close proximity to your vehicle, typically within 10-30 feet. It’s incredibly useful for:
- Adjusting Camera Angle: Ensuring your live view dash cam front and rear cameras are perfectly aligned to capture the optimal view.
- Checking Parking Proximity: When backing into a tight spot, especially with a rear camera feed.
- Incident Review: Immediately reviewing an event without having to remove the SD card.
- Data Transfer Speeds: Modern Wi-Fi standards like Wi-Fi 5 or Wi-Fi 6 in higher-end models ensure a smooth, low-latency live stream, often in high definition. Data shows that a stable Wi-Fi connection can support real-time streaming of 1080p footage with minimal delay, usually less than 200 milliseconds.
- Security Concerns: While convenient, direct Wi-Fi connections are generally secure as they are typically password-protected and don’t broadcast sensitive information beyond the direct link. However, users should always ensure their dash cam’s Wi-Fi password is strong and unique.
Cloud Connectivity and Remote Live View
For truly advanced remote live view dash cam functionality, cloud integration becomes crucial. This takes the Wi-Fi connectivity a step further, enabling access from virtually anywhere with an internet connection.
- LTE Module Requirement: To achieve remote live view, the dash cam needs its own cellular LTE module, similar to what’s found in a smartphone. This module allows the camera to connect to mobile data networks 4G, 5G.
- Subscription Services: Remote live view typically requires a subscription service from the dash cam manufacturer. This covers the data costs for transmitting video to the cloud and then to your remote device. For example, some premium dash cam brands report that about 10-15% of their users opt for these subscription plans, highlighting a growing demand for off-site monitoring.
- Use Cases:
- Parking Surveillance: Receiving instant notifications and being able to view live footage if your car is bumped or tampered with while parked miles away.
- Fleet Management: Businesses monitoring their vehicle fleet in real-time.
- Security Alerts: Triggering alerts and live viewing if motion or impact is detected.
- Data Usage Considerations: Streaming high-definition video over cellular data can consume significant amounts of data. A continuous stream of 1080p video might use 1-2 GB per hour, so understanding your data plan and the camera’s settings e.g., lower resolution for remote viewing is essential.

Key Features to Look For in a Live View Dash Cam
When shopping for a live view dash cam, the market can feel overwhelming. To ensure you pick the best live view dash cam for your needs, focus on a core set of features that directly impact performance, reliability, and usability. Dash cam with live gps tracking
Video Resolution and Quality
The primary function of any dash cam is to record clear video, and live view benefits directly from high resolution.
- Minimum 1080p Full HD: This should be the absolute minimum. 1080p provides sufficient detail to discern license plates and road signs in most conditions.
- 1440p 2K or 2160p 4K UHD: These resolutions offer significantly more detail, which is crucial for identifying intricate details like facial features or small objects at a distance. 4K dash cams are becoming more prevalent, with market data showing a 25% increase in their adoption over the past two years.
- Frames Per Second FPS: Aim for at least 30 FPS for smooth video. 60 FPS especially at 1080p offers even smoother playback and better capture of fast-moving objects.
- Wide Dynamic Range WDR / High Dynamic Range HDR: These features are essential for balancing exposure in challenging lighting conditions e.g., exiting a tunnel, driving at sunrise/sunset. They prevent footage from being either too dark or overexposed.
- Low-Light Performance: Look for cameras with good low-light sensors e.g., Sony STARVIS or similar for clear night recordings. Without adequate low-light capability, even high-resolution footage can be useless in the dark.
Parking Surveillance Modes
For any dash cam, especially one with live view, robust parking surveillance is a critical feature for protecting your vehicle when you’re away.
- Impact/Motion Detection: The camera should automatically begin recording when it detects a physical impact e.g., a door ding, fender bender or motion around the vehicle.
- Buffered Recording: This is key. Buffered parking mode means the camera constantly records a small loop, and upon detection of an event, it saves the footage before and after the event. This ensures you don’t miss the crucial moments leading up to an incident.
- Time-Lapse Recording: Some dash cams offer a time-lapse parking mode, where they capture a frame every few seconds, compressing hours of footage into a short, reviewable clip. This saves storage space and battery.
- Hardwiring Kit: For continuous parking surveillance, a hardwiring kit is almost always required to draw power directly from your car’s battery with voltage protection to prevent battery drain. Approximately 65% of dash cam owners who use parking mode opt for hardwired installations.
- Dash Cam EV Setting: As mentioned, if you drive an EV, ensure the dash cam has specific settings or compatibility to minimize power drain during parking mode, protecting your vehicle’s high-voltage battery.
Connectivity Wi-Fi, Bluetooth, LTE
The ability to connect your dash cam to other devices is what enables live view and remote functionality.
- Built-in Wi-Fi: Essential for local live viewing and footage transfer to your smartphone. This allows you to easily connect and view your live view dash cam feed.
- Bluetooth: Often used for initial setup and seamless pairing with the smartphone app, sometimes acting as a quick activation trigger for Wi-Fi.
- LTE Module Optional: For true remote live view dash cam capabilities and cloud features, an integrated LTE module is necessary. This requires a separate data plan or subscription. Only about 15-20% of premium dash cams currently offer built-in LTE, but this segment is growing.
- Cloud Integration: If you desire remote access, look for cloud support. This allows recorded event footage to be uploaded to a cloud server, accessible from anywhere.
GPS Functionality
Integrated GPS adds invaluable data to your recorded footage.
- Location Tracking: Records your vehicle’s exact coordinates.
- Speed Data: Logs your driving speed.
- Route Mapping: Allows you to review your driving routes on a map.
- Time Synchronization: Ensures accurate date and time stamps on your footage, critical for evidence. GPS data can be crucial in accident reconstruction, with legal experts often requesting it.
Other Important Considerations
Beyond the core features, several other aspects contribute to the overall utility and user experience of a live view dash cam.
- Storage Capacity and Overwrite: Dash cams record continuously. Ensure it supports high-capacity microSD cards e.g., 128GB, 256GB, 512GB and features loop recording, which automatically overwrites the oldest footage when the card is full.
- Supercapacitor vs. Battery: Supercapacitors are preferred over internal batteries, especially in extreme temperatures, as they are more durable and reliable. Batteries can swell or degrade in heat. Over 80% of top-rated dash cams now use supercapacitors.
- Display Screen or lack thereof: Some dash cams have small integrated screens, while others like most mirror dash cams use the entire mirror, and some are screen-less, relying solely on your smartphone for live view. Consider your preference.
- Voice Control: A hands-free way to operate certain functions e.g., “record emergency video”.
- Advanced Driver-Assistance Systems ADAS: Features like Lane Departure Warning LDW and Forward Collision Warning FCW can be integrated into some dash cams, though their accuracy can vary.
- User-Friendly App Interface: A clunky app can ruin the live view experience. Look for reviews that praise the accompanying mobile application’s intuitiveness and stability.
Setting Up and Optimizing Your Live View Dash Cam
Getting your live view dash cam up and running smoothly is crucial for maximizing its benefits.
From initial installation to fine-tuning settings, a methodical approach ensures you get the most out of your device.
Strategic Placement and Mounting
The physical placement of your dash cam directly impacts its effectiveness in capturing incidents and providing clear live views.
- Front Camera:
- Behind the Rearview Mirror: This is the ideal spot. It keeps the camera out of your direct line of sight, preventing distractions, and often places it within the sweep of your windshield wipers, ensuring a clear view in rain or snow.
- Center of the Windshield: Ensures a balanced view of the road ahead.
- Avoid Airbag Deployment Zones: Never mount the camera in an area where an airbag deploys. Consult your vehicle’s manual.
- Rear Camera:
- Top Center of Rear Window: Provides the widest and most unobstructed view of the rear.
- Clear of Defroster Lines and Wipers: Ensure the lens is not obstructed by defroster lines or out of the wiper’s sweep.
- Interior Camera if applicable:
- Usually Integrated with Front Unit: If separate, mount it to capture the entire cabin.
- Secure Mounting: Use the provided adhesive mounts or suction cups. Adhesive mounts are generally more secure and less prone to falling off in extreme temperatures. Many professional installers report that 95% of their clients opt for adhesive mounts for long-term stability.
- Cable Management: Neatly tuck cables along the headliner, A-pillar, and dashboard edges. This isn’t just for aesthetics. it prevents cables from interfering with your driving and ensures they don’t get snagged.
Powering Your Dash Cam
Reliable power is essential for continuous operation, especially for parking surveillance.
- Cigarette Lighter Adapter Temporary/Basic: The easiest way to power the camera, but it only works when the car is on or the accessory socket is always live. Not ideal for parking mode.
- Hardwiring Kit Recommended for Parking Mode: Connects directly to your car’s fuse box, providing constant power.
- ACC Fuse: Power that turns on/off with the ignition.
- Constant Fuse: Power that is always on.
- Ground: Connects to the vehicle’s metal chassis.
- Voltage Cut-off: A good hardwiring kit will have a built-in voltage cut-off to prevent your car battery from draining completely, typically shutting off the camera if the voltage drops below 12V. Over 70% of dash cam users who utilize parking mode hardwire their devices.
- OBD-II Power Cable: An alternative to hardwiring, plugging into the OBD-II port. Easier installation but may block the port for other diagnostics.
Connecting to the Smartphone App
The app is your gateway to live view and settings adjustments. Top rated dash cam
- Download the Correct App: Search for your specific dash cam model’s app on the App Store or Google Play.
- Enable Wi-Fi on Dash Cam: Most dash cams have a button or menu option to activate their Wi-Fi hotspot.
- Connect Your Phone: Go to your phone’s Wi-Fi settings and select the dash cam’s Wi-Fi network it will usually have the brand name and model number. Enter the default password often “12345678” or similar, but change it immediately for security.
- Launch the App: Open the dash cam app. You should now see options for “Live View,” “Gallery,” “Settings,” etc. Many premium apps offer a seamless connection process, with 85% of users finding them intuitive within the first few uses.
- Initial Setup and Formatting: The app will guide you through initial setup, including formatting the microSD card.
Optimizing Settings for Live View and Recording
Fine-tuning your dash cam’s settings ensures optimal performance and caters to your preferences.
- Resolution and FPS: Set the highest resolution your camera supports e.g., 4K and typically 30 FPS. If you need smoother footage for fast action, 60 FPS often at 1080p might be an option.
- Exposure Value EV Setting: If your dash cam has a dash cam EV setting, you can adjust it to brighten or darken the video. A slightly higher EV can help in low light, but too high can cause overexposure in bright conditions. Experiment to find the optimal balance for your environment.
- G-Sensor Sensitivity: This determines how sensitive the camera is to impacts.
- Driving Mode: Set to medium-low to prevent constant event recording from minor bumps.
- Parking Mode: Set to medium-high to ensure even slight nudges trigger recording.
- Motion Detection Sensitivity: For parking mode, adjust this to prevent constant recording from passing leaves or shadows, but ensure it captures human or vehicle movement.
- Parking Mode Options: Select your preferred parking mode impact, motion, time-lapse, or a combination.
- Loop Recording: Ensure it’s enabled so your camera doesn’t stop recording when the SD card is full.
- Date and Time: Verify these are accurate. GPS-enabled dash cams usually sync automatically.
- Audio Recording: Decide if you want audio recorded. Most dash cams record audio by default, but you can typically disable it for privacy reasons if needed.
- Wi-Fi Password: Crucially, change the default Wi-Fi password to a strong, unique one. This prevents unauthorized access to your live feed and recordings.

Troubleshooting Common Live View Dash Cam Issues
Even the best live view dash cam can sometimes throw a curveball. From connection glitches to recording failures, understanding common issues and their fixes can save you a lot of frustration. Most problems are minor and solvable with a few simple steps.
Connectivity Problems Wi-Fi and Remote
This is the most frequent complaint with live view dash cams.
If you can’t see the live feed or connect, start here.
- “Can’t Connect to Dash Cam Wi-Fi”:
- Check Wi-Fi Status: Ensure the dash cam’s Wi-Fi hotspot is actually enabled. Many models have a button or a specific voice command to activate it.
- Forget and Reconnect: On your phone, “forget” the dash cam’s Wi-Fi network and then try connecting again, re-entering the password.
- Proximity: Ensure you are within range usually 10-30 feet of the dash cam for direct Wi-Fi connections.
- Incorrect Password: Double-check you’re entering the correct Wi-Fi password. If you changed it from the default, make sure you remember the new one.
- Interference: Other electronic devices or even tinted windows can sometimes cause minor Wi-Fi interference. Try moving your phone slightly.
- “Live View Is Laggy or Stutters”:
- Resolution Settings: If streaming in 4K over Wi-Fi, try lowering the live view resolution within the app settings. High-resolution streams require more bandwidth.
- Network Congestion Remote View: If using remote live view via LTE, a poor cellular signal on either your phone or the dash cam’s end can cause lag. Check signal strength.
- App Glitch: Close and reopen the dash cam app, or even restart your phone.
- SD Card Speed: While less common for live view, a slow SD card can sometimes contribute to overall system sluggishness.
- “Remote Live View Not Working”:
- LTE Module Status: Ensure your dash cam’s LTE module is active and has a strong cellular signal. Check the LED indicator on the camera.
- Subscription Active: Verify your cloud/LTE subscription is current and hasn’t expired.
- Data Limit Reached: You might have hit your monthly data cap for the dash cam’s LTE service.
- Firewall/Network Restrictions: If connecting from a corporate network, firewalls might block the connection. Try connecting via your phone’s mobile data. Data from support centers indicates that over 40% of remote live view issues stem from subscription or data plan problems.
Recording and Footage Playback Issues
If your live view works but recordings are problematic, the issue often lies with the storage or power.
- “Dash Cam Not Recording”:
- SD Card Check: This is the #1 culprit.
- Is the SD card inserted correctly?
- Is it formatted in the dash cam or app? Dash cams require frequent formatting, typically every 1-2 months, to maintain optimal performance.
- Is it a high-quality, reputable brand e.g., SanDisk High Endurance, Samsung Pro Endurance designed for continuous recording? Generic cards often fail prematurely.
- Is it full? Loop recording should prevent this, but check if it’s disabled.
- Power Supply: Is the camera receiving continuous power? If it only records when driving, the parking mode power setup might be faulty.
- Firmware Update: Outdated firmware can cause recording glitches. Check the manufacturer’s website for updates.

- “Corrupted Files or Missing Footage”:
- SD Card Degradation: SD cards have a limited lifespan, especially with continuous write cycles. If you’re experiencing frequent corruption, it’s likely time for a new card.
- Sudden Power Loss: If the camera loses power unexpectedly e.g., hardwire kit malfunction, vehicle battery drain, the last recorded file might not be saved properly.
- Firmware Bug: Again, check for firmware updates.
Power and Battery Drain Concerns
Especially relevant for users relying on parking mode or specific dash cam EV setting adjustments.
- “Dash Cam Drains Car Battery”:
- Hardwiring Kit Voltage Cut-off: Ensure your hardwiring kit has a voltage cut-off and that it’s set correctly e.g., 12V or 12.2V. If the cut-off is too low or non-existent, it will drain your battery.
- Parking Mode Settings: High sensitivity for motion or impact detection can cause the camera to record more frequently, leading to higher power consumption. Lowering sensitivity can help.
- Old Car Battery: An aging car battery typically 3-5 years old might not hold a charge well enough to support continuous dash cam operation in parking mode. Over 20% of reported battery drain issues are linked to an aging vehicle battery.
- Dash Cam EV Setting: For electric vehicles, ensure you’ve utilized any specific EV-optimized power settings within the dash cam to minimize 12V battery drain.
- “Dash Cam Overheats”:
- Direct Sunlight: Avoid direct exposure to prolonged sunlight when parked.
- Ventilation: Ensure no vents on the dash cam are blocked.
- Internal Temperature Sensor: Most quality dash cams will shut down if they get too hot to prevent damage. This is normal.
- Supercapacitor vs. Battery: Supercapacitor-based dash cams handle heat much better than battery-based ones.
Mirror Dash Cam Specific Issues
If you’re wondering how to use mirror dash cam features and run into problems, these might be unique.
- “Mirror Display Not Bright Enough”:
- Brightness Setting: Adjust the screen brightness in the dash cam’s settings menu.
- Glare: Direct sunlight can cause glare. Some higher-end models have anti-glare screens.
- “Rear Camera Not Displaying”:
- Cable Connection: Check the cable running from the main mirror unit to the rear camera. Ensure it’s securely plugged in at both ends.
- Damaged Cable: The cable might be pinched or damaged.
- Faulty Rear Camera: In rare cases, the rear camera unit itself might be defective.
In almost all cases, a firmware update check the manufacturer’s website, a full reset of the dash cam usually a small pinhole button, or a new, high-endurance SD card will resolve most persistent issues. If problems persist, contacting the manufacturer’s support is the next logical step.
Legal and Ethical Considerations for Dash Cam Usage
While dash cams offer undeniable benefits for security and evidence, their use, especially with live view capabilities, comes with legal and ethical considerations that vary by region and context. Best dash cam with gps tracking
Being aware of these is crucial for responsible ownership.
Privacy Laws and Consent
The ability to record and live stream public and private spaces raises significant privacy concerns.
- Public vs. Private Property: Generally, recording in public spaces where there’s no expectation of privacy e.g., public roads is permissible. However, recording individuals on private property or within their homes without consent is often illegal.
- Two-Party vs. One-Party Consent States:
- One-Party Consent: In these states, only one person involved in a conversation needs to consent to it being recorded.
- Two-Party Consent: In these states, all parties involved in a conversation must consent to it being recorded. This is particularly relevant if your dash cam records audio inside the vehicle. A recent survey indicated that approximately 38% of US states require two-party consent for audio recording.
- Passenger Consent for interior cameras: If you use a multi-channel dash cam with an interior camera, especially for ridesharing, you may be legally required to inform passengers that they are being recorded both video and audio. Displaying clear signage within the vehicle is often recommended or even mandated.
- “Can You Live Stream a Dash Cam?”: Yes, technically you can, but consider the privacy implications. Streaming public roads is generally fine, but streaming into private property or capturing identifiable individuals without their consent can lead to legal issues.
Data Storage and Security
Live view dash cams, especially those with cloud connectivity, handle sensitive data.
- Cloud Storage Security: If your dash cam uploads footage to a cloud service, ensure the provider has robust security measures, including encryption, to protect your data from unauthorized access. Read their privacy policy carefully.
- Local Storage Security: Protect your physical SD card. If the dash cam is stolen, the footage could be compromised. While not a common feature, some high-end dash cams offer encrypted local storage.
- Wi-Fi Password Security: As mentioned, change the default Wi-Fi password on your dash cam to a strong, unique one to prevent unauthorized access to your local live feed.
- GDPR and Other Data Protection Laws: If you travel internationally or operate a fleet across borders, be aware of regional data protection regulations like GDPR in Europe that govern how personal data including video footage of individuals can be collected, stored, and processed.
Usage in Specific Scenarios
Certain situations demand extra vigilance regarding dash cam usage.
- Ridesharing/Commercial Use:
- Disclosure: Always disclose to passengers via signage or verbally that recording is taking place.
- Company Policies: Adhere to the policies of your rideshare company Uber, Lyft, etc. regarding dash cam use. Many require disclosure.
- Commercial Vehicle Regulations: Commercial vehicles may have specific regulations regarding recording devices.
- Accident Reporting and Evidence:
- Submitting Footage: While dash cam footage is valuable evidence, be prepared for law enforcement or insurance companies to request it. Know your rights regarding self-incrimination.
- Tampering: Never tamper with or alter footage. This can severely undermine its credibility as evidence.
- International Travel: Laws vary significantly from country to country. In some nations e.g., Austria, Germany to some extent, dash cam use is heavily restricted or even illegal due to strict privacy laws. Always research the local regulations before traveling with a dash cam. A 2023 report noted that dash cam usage laws vary widely, with over 15 countries having strict regulations.
Ethical Considerations
Beyond legalities, there are ethical responsibilities when using a dash cam.
- Respect for Privacy: Even in public spaces, consider the ethical implications of continuously recording others. Avoid using footage for malicious purposes or public shaming.
- Responsible Sharing: If sharing footage online e.g., of a reckless driver, consider blurring license plates or faces of uninvolved parties to protect their privacy.
- Not a Replacement for Driver Attention: A dash cam is an assistive device, not a replacement for attentive driving. Never let the presence of a camera distract you from the road.
- Avoiding Misinformation: Ensure that any footage shared is presented accurately and without misleading context.
By understanding and adhering to these legal and ethical considerations, dash cam owners can leverage the powerful benefits of live view technology responsibly and avoid potential pitfalls.
